After moving to a 15-month high on Monday, London’s equity markets slipped yesterday as dealers took profits. The FTSE 100 index fell back 0.7 per cent, losing 31.1 points to close at 43789, while the FTSE 250 did slightly better and climbed 27.2 points to end the day at 5780.2. The biggest mover was probably MyTravel, which lost half a penny to close at 11.25p ahead of its annual results, which are due to be published imminently.
